Table 1-8. System Messages (continued) Message Causes Corrective Actions Shutdown failure Shutdown test failure. See "Troubleshooting System Memory" on page 156. The amount of system memory has changed Memory has been added or removed or a memory module may be faulty. If memory has been added or removed, this message is informative and can be ignored. If memory has not been added or removed, check the SEL to determine if single-bit or multi-bit errors were detected and replace the faulty memory module. See "Troubleshooting System Memory" on page 156. This system supports only Opteron n series processors. Microprocessor(s) is not supported by the system. Install a supported microprocessor or microprocessor combination. See "Installing a Processor" on page 101. Time-of-day clock Faulty battery or faulty stopped chip. See "Troubleshooting the System Battery" on page 153. Time-of-day not set - please run SETUP program Incorrect Time or Date settings; faulty system battery. Check the Time and Date settings. See "Using the System Setup Program" on page 43. If the problem persists, replace the system battery. See "System Battery" on page 115.
